I watched the highlights and was quite pleased with England in the first half. They defended well and made some good counterattacking moves. they didn't panic at the back and tried to play the ball intelligently even when under pressure. They created a couple of chances that matched anything that Spain came up with.
Sadly, in the second half they reverted to type. Gave the ball away cheaply.....Sterling waited until his left back had bombed past him before giving the ball away and completely opening up the right for Spain to score the first of their two goals...... dithered on the ball, because they didn't know what to do with it, passed back to the keeper so that he could hand possession straight back to Spain (leading to their second goal), lumped the ball away when clearing their lines. In the end the 2-0 scoreline flattered England... they could easily have lost that 3 or 4 nil... probably should have done, in truth.
Then again, that was miles away from being England's first choice XI. One hopeless centre back with a modest makeweight midfielder partnering him. Of the starting XI, probably only Hart, Carrick, and Sterling would be guaranteed a berth under normal circumstances. It is at least heartening that Roy is prepared to give a lot of younger players the chance to stake a claim for next year.... he may have had little choice, of course.
